How to submit an application for a UK visa?

It is mandatory to visit the UK Visa Application Centre in person to submit the application and for biometric enrollment. You can make an application in 3 easy steps:-

  1. Pay your visa fee at the designated bank or alternatively at the bank teller counter at the Visa Application Centre. Click here to ascertain the amount of visa fee payable and various visa fee payment options.
  2. Print the visa application form & complete the same.
  3. Visit the UK Visa Application Centre to submit your visa application pack and for biometrics enrollment along with the mandatory and recommended set of documents.

The recent High Court ruling in the UK resulting from the Highly Skilled Forum Judicial Review affects certain people who formerly had leave in the UK under the Highly Skilled Migrant Programme (HSMP). You may be covered by this ruling if you joined HSMP under the arrangements which were in place until the scheme was suspended on 7 November 2006 and you either:

a) applied for and were refused further leave to remain under the new extension rules which came into force on 5 December 2006, and subsequently left the UK, or
b) left the UK after 7 November 2006 without ever applying for further leave to remain under the new rules.

A policy document which explains in detail who is affected by the ruling is available on the UK Border Agency website. Forms, guidance and information on supporting documents for those overseas who think they are affected by the ruling and who wish to apply for entry clearance to return to the UK as a highly skilled migrant are being prepared and will be available on the UK Border Agency Visa Services website.
